From 9f902a6fe67a987bf09d310723f48e856168351b Mon Sep 17 00:00:00 2001 From: Tom Willemsen Date: Tue, 7 Aug 2012 21:37:20 +0200 Subject: Add python2-dispass-git --- python2-dispass-git/PKGBUILD | 46 ++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 46 insertions(+) create mode 100644 python2-dispass-git/PKGBUILD diff --git a/python2-dispass-git/PKGBUILD b/python2-dispass-git/PKGBUILD new file mode 100644 index 0000000..87c5d4e --- /dev/null +++ b/python2-dispass-git/PKGBUILD @@ -0,0 +1,46 @@ +# Maintainer: Tom Willemsen + +python=python2 +name=DisPass + +pkgname=$python-dispass-git +pkgver=20120807 +pkgrel=1 +pkgdesc="Generate and disperse/dispell passwords" +depends=('python2') +makedepends=('python2-distribute') +arch=('any') +url="http://dispass.babab.nl/" +license=("custom:ISC") +conflicts=(python2-dispass) + +_gitroot=git://github.com/babab/DisPass.git +_gitname=master + +build() { + cd "$srcdir" + + if [ ! -d $name ]; then + git clone $_gitroot $name; + cd $name + else + cd $name + git pull origin $_gitname + fi + + python2 setup.py build || return 1 +} + +package() { + cd "$srcdir/$name" + python2 setup.py install --root="$pkgdir" + + install -Dm644 "${srcdir}/${name}/skel/dot.dispass" \ + "${pkgdir}/etc/skel/.dispass" + install -Dm644 "${srcdir}/${name}/dispass.1" \ + "${pkgdir}/usr/share/man/man1/dispass.1" + install -Dm644 "${srcdir}/${name}/LICENSE" \ + "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E" + install -Dm644 "${srcdir}/${name}/README.rst" \ + "${pkgdir}/usr/share/doc/${pkgname}/README.rst" +} -- cgit v1.2.3-54-g00ecf